The artwork titled “Girl with Black Cat” was created by Giovanni Boldini in 1885. It belongs to the Realism movement and is classified under the portrait genre.
In the artwork, Boldini skillfully captures a young girl holding a black cat against a rich, crimson background. The girl’s expression is tender and contemplative, her brown eyes and soft features conveying a sense of innocence and harmony. The cat, with its emerald eyes, complements the overall composition by providing a stark contrast through its dark fur. The artist’s meticulous attention to detail and his adept manipulation of light and shadow enhance the realism and depth of the scene, resulting in a vivid portrayal of the bond between the girl and her pet.
